Job Details

Job Details:

We are seeking a seasoned and dynamic Human Resources Manager with experience in the engineering industry to join our growing team. As the HR Manager, you will lead and manage the HR department, ensuring the effective implementation of HR strategies, policies, and programs. This role involves overseeing recruitment, employee relations, compliance, and other HR functions to support the organization's objectives and foster a positive work environment. This is a permanent position requiring a minimum of 5 years of experience in a similar role.

Responsibilities:
  • Oversee the recruitment and selection process to attract and hire top talent. This includes developing job descriptions, posting job ads, screening applicants, conducting interviews, and facilitating the hiring and onboarding process.
  • Foster a positive and inclusive work environment, promoting diversity, inclusivity, and a culture of respect and collaboration.
  • Address and resolve employee conflicts and grievances promptly and professionally, ensuring fair and equitable treatment of all employees.
  • Ensure compliance with legal requirements related to compensation and benefits, staying up-to-date with the latest regulations and best practices.
  • Identify training needs and develop comprehensive training programs to enhance employee skills and performance.
  • Evaluate the effectiveness of training programs and make improvements as needed to ensure they meet the organization's objectives.
  • Develop, implement, and update HR policies and procedures, ensuring they align with the organization's goals and comply with federal, state, and local labor laws and regulations.
  • Conduct regular HR audits and maintain accurate employee records, ensuring data integrity and confidentiality.
  • Promote workplace safety and ensure compliance with occupational health and safety regulations.
  • Lead and mentor the HR team, providing guidance and support to help them reach their full potential.
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or related field.
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in a Human Resources Manager role, preferably in the construction or manufacturing industry.
  • Proven experience in leading and managing a HR team.
  • Strong knowledge of HR functions (recruitment, employee relations, training & development etc.)
  • Understanding of federal, state, and local labor laws and regulations.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to handle sensitive information with discretion.
  • Strong leadership and team management skills, with the ability to inspire and motivate others.
  • Proficiency in HR software and MS Office Suite.
  • Professional certification in Human Resources (e.g., PHR, SPHR, SHRM-CP) is a plus.
